The role of the exhaust valve compared to the discharge port

Many people confuse the exhaust valve with the waste valve, and while both these car parts are similar, they perform completely different functions and for completely different reasons.As we mentioned, blowdown valves exist to eliminate turbine vibration. They are located on the air intake side of the turbo, and they are normally closed. When a BOV detects an excessive amount of pressure in the turbo inlet, it opens and allows that pressure to escape. Is Turbo Flutter bad?

The answer to this question is not as simple as it seems. It’s complicated by the fact that there are a lot of misconceptions about turbochargers out there. But let’s start with the basics. Turbine wobble is nothing more than a ton of back pressure flowing through your turbocharger, and as such, it puts a lot of strain on your turbocharger. The manufacturer never designed the turbo to handle all these stresses, and so it can cause your turbocharger to wear out prematurely. The truth is it can be, but it usually isn’t. Yes, the manufacturer didn’t design the turbo to handle excessive stress, but they designed the turbo to handle tons of boost, which means it’s pretty durable.
